Monday's dominant 8.883 million viewers, the program's strongest telecast in five months, reflects the immediate market reaction to ABC World News Tonight's extensive coverage of the deadly 7.4-magnitude Colombia earthquake that struck on August 10. Traders recognize how major breaking international disasters reliably spike linear and streaming tune-in for the evening newscast, outpacing routine domestic stories or severe Midwest storm tracking on subsequent days. With the full Nielsen data now confirming Monday's clear lead, the 100% implied probability leaves little room for revision unless late adjustments reveal an unexpected surge elsewhere in the week.

This market will resolve according to the day of the week on which the edition of ABC World News Tonight with the highest number of U.S. viewers (Persons 2+ average total viewers, P2+) aired during the Week of August 10 - August 16, as reported on the Linear TV Top 10 Total Chart.
This market will resolve based on the first official estimate reported by Nielsen. Any later revisions or retractions will have no bearing on resolution.
If Nielsen reports an entry for ABC World News Tonight without specifying the day of the week on which it aired, that entry will be treated as having aired on Monday.
If the specified show does not appear on the final chart for the specified week, this market will resolve to "Monday".
If two or more editions of ABC World News Tonight are reported with the same number of viewers, and that figure is the highest reported for the specified week, this market will resolve to the earliest of those days within the Monday-Sunday week.
If the data for the specified week is entirely unreleased by 11:59 PM ET on the second Thursday following the specified week, this market will resolve to "Monday". If the data for the specified week remains partially published (i.e. excluding certain days of the week) by that time, this market will resolve based on the viewership data available at that point.
This market will resolve according to Nielsen’s P2+ viewership statistic for the specified week, as reported on the Linear TV Top 10 Total Chart, regardless of any future changes in methodology.
The resolution source for this market will be information from Nielsen, specifically their P2+ viewership statistic as reported on the Linear TV Top 10 Total Chart (see: https://www.nielsen.com/data-center/top-ten/#television).
